about summary refs log tree commit homepage
path: root/lib/PublicInbox/SearchIdx.pm
diff options
context:
space:
mode:
authorEric Wong <e@80x24.org>2016-09-09 00:01:28 +0000
committerEric Wong <e@80x24.org>2016-09-09 00:02:24 +0000
commit4d9ad68e6565e488c9fa8e8e314178624827785c (patch)
treebf885c388cbc95f525ed3f0b5345e71bba8ed40d /lib/PublicInbox/SearchIdx.pm
parent1b14910344c10f85ce29281a5a7803ab3b2971be (diff)
downloadpublic-inbox-4d9ad68e6565e488c9fa8e8e314178624827785c.tar.gz
Specifying the "d:" field only worked for
NumberValueRangeProcessor in older versions of Xapian, such
as the one in Debian wheezy (libsearch-xapian-perl=1.2.10.0-1)

This slipped through since I rarely use wheezy, anymore, and
perhaps nobody else does, either.  Perhaps wheezy support may be
dropped, soon.

Unfortunately, this requires a schema version bump.
Diffstat (limited to 'lib/PublicInbox/SearchIdx.pm')
-rw-r--r--lib/PublicInbox/SearchIdx.pm2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/PublicInbox/SearchIdx.pm b/lib/PublicInbox/SearchIdx.pm
index 0e499ad1..86be9ed4 100644
--- a/lib/PublicInbox/SearchIdx.pm
+++ b/lib/PublicInbox/SearchIdx.pm
@@ -117,7 +117,7 @@ sub add_values ($$$) {
                         $smsg->{mime}->body_raw =~ tr!\n!\n!);
 
         my $yyyymmdd = strftime('%Y%m%d', gmtime($ts));
-        $doc->add_value(&PublicInbox::Search::YYYYMMDD, $yyyymmdd);
+        add_val($doc, PublicInbox::Search::YYYYMMDD, $yyyymmdd);
 }
 
 sub index_users ($$) {